Understanding Tension Headaches: Causes and Symptoms

When you experience a tension headache, it often arises from factors such as stress, poor posture, or muscle tension in your neck and shoulders. These headaches typically present as a dull, aching pain that feels like a tight band around your head, with sensitivity often felt in the temples, forehead, or the back of your head.

You may also notice tightness in the muscles around your neck and shoulders, making movement uncomfortable. The symptoms can vary from person to person, and while you might experience mild sensitivity to light or sound, unlike migraines, tension headaches typically don’t lead to nausea or vomiting.

Understanding the causes of your headaches can empower you to manage symptoms more effectively. Common triggers include stress and prolonged sitting, especially in poor postures.

The Importance of Ergonomics at Your Workspace

Your workspace plays a crucial role in your physical well-being, and making ergonomic adjustments can significantly help you avoid discomfort, including tension headaches. As a chiropractor, I want to share some simple yet effective tips to create a healthier workspace that supports your spine and overall comfort.

Start with your chair: ensure it supports your back properly and adjust it so your feet rest flat on the floor with your knees at hip level. This alignment is vital for maintaining good posture and preventing strain on your spine.

Next, consider your desk height. It should allow your elbows to bend at a 90-degree angle when typing. This position not only promotes comfort but also reduces the risk of developing musculoskeletal issues over time.

Your computer screen should be positioned at eye level. This helps prevent unnecessary neck and back strain, which can lead to headaches. If you often refer to documents, a document holder can keep your papers at the same level as your screen, further reducing strain.

Lighting is another important factor. Proper illumination can minimize eye strain, which is a common contributor to headaches. Be sure your workspace is well-lit to promote a comfortable working environment.

Finally, keep your workspace organized. Having frequently used items within easy reach helps avoid unnecessary stretching or bending, which can lead to discomfort.

By making these simple adjustments, you can create a workspace that not only enhances your productivity but also supports your spinal health.

Progressive Muscle Relaxation

While there are various relaxation techniques available to help alleviate tension headaches, Progressive Muscle Relaxation (PMR) is a valuable method that complements chiropractic care in promoting overall wellness and stress relief.

By focusing on systematically tensing and relaxing different muscle groups, you can effectively release built-up tension in your body, which can be a contributing factor to headaches.

Here’s how to practice PMR in a way that enhances your health and aligns with a chiropractic approach:

  • Create a Calm Environment: Find a quiet and comfortable space where you can sit or lie down without distractions. This sets the stage for relaxation and mindfulness.
  • Start from the Bottom Up: Begin with your feet and gradually work your way up through your body. This methodical approach allows you to focus on each area and helps you become more aware of how tension manifests in different muscle groups.
  • Tense and Release: For each muscle group, tense the muscles for about 5 seconds, then relax them for 30 seconds. Pay close attention to how your body feels during this process. Notice the difference between tension and relaxation—it’s a great way to become more in tune with your body.
  • Mindfulness Connection: As you practice PMR, consider integrating breathing techniques to further enhance relaxation. Deep, slow breaths can help calm your mind and body, supporting the overall goal of reducing stress.

The Benefits of a Consistent Sleep Schedule

Establishing a consistent sleep schedule can be a game-changer for reducing tension headaches and improving your overall well-being. When you prioritize getting to bed and waking up at the same time every day, your body learns to expect rest, helping to regulate your internal clock. This not only leads to better sleep quality and duration but also supports your body in managing stress and tension—two common triggers for headaches.

In addition to helping with headaches, a regular sleep routine can boost your mental clarity and emotional stability. When you get enough sleep, you’ll find it easier to handle daily stressors, which can further decrease the chances of experiencing tension headaches.

Plus, avoiding late nights and erratic sleep patterns can help minimize fatigue, a common contributor to headache onset. To maximize your health, try to stick to your sleep routine even on weekends. Aim for 7-9 hours of restful sleep each night.
